In "The Last of the Plainsmen," Zane Grey masterfully weaves a narrative that captures the essence of the American West through the eyes of a friendly and adventurous protagonist. This semi-autobiographical work, steeped in naturalistic descriptions and vivid characterizations, paints a poignant picture of frontier life and the transition from untamed wilderness to civilization. Grey's prose is imbued with a romanticism that champions the rugged individualism of Western pioneers, while also hinting at the inevitable encroachment of modernity that threatens their way of life. The book is a synthesis of adventure and reflection, echoing the themes of exploration and existential struggle prominent in early 20th-century American literature. Zane Grey, a seminal figure in Western fiction, drew upon his own experiences as both an avid outdoorsman and a passionate storyteller. His extensive travels throughout the American West, coupled with his keen observations of the landscapes and people he encountered, offered Grey a unique insight into the human condition on the frontier. This profound connection to the land and its storied past undoubtedly informed his narrative choices in "The Last of the Plainsmen," enriching the text with authenticity and depth.
